India have managed to put enough pressure on the Kiwi batters with accurate bowling and tight fielding. As cricket experts say, fielding always wins matches for any side and that is the case for the Indians these days.
Although India took early wickets, Daryl Mitchell, the beast in form for New Zealand, scored another half-century against India and took control of the Kiwi innings which seemed to be falling apart at one point. At that point, chances were dropped by the Indian fielders.

Gautam Gambhir and Virat Kohli disgusted as Harshit Rana’s poor fielding saved Glenn Phillips
Nitish Kumar Reddy has received the ball relatively more often this time in Indore. He has been very economical from his side and Glenn Phillips, seeing the pressure mounting on him, seemed to want to take out the fifth bowling option for India.
However, Phillips, who never looked comfortable with the shot, ran out of space and pushed the shot towards the square leg area. As the ball went up, Harshit Rana, who was standing between fine leg and square leg area, got a chance to grab the ball.
If he had started just in time he could have easily gained ground as the ball had been in the air for a long time. Gautam Gambhir closed his eyes and hit his head back in frustration while Virat Kohli, who also seemed equally interested, was not happy with how things ended as Harshit Rana misjudged the catch.
